West Virginia. (I might be biased)
Closeish to "stuff" on the east coast that you may want to do/vacation to and you can drive instead of fly. Low population, Mostly white, good people (a little redneck). Cheap houses and low taxes. For example the house we bought last year (built in 1993) is 1120 sqft (with a full basement not included) so 2240 total living area with 18 acres. Paid $88.5k, Property taxes are $500/yr and we now have the "farm" tax rate so our taxes will be $200/yr as long as we can show $1000 in "farm products" per year. (We did hay from 2.5 acres...350 sq bales @ $3 each = $1050 the trick is you dont actually have to SELL them, just produce them and value what they are worth to YOU) Not so freaking cold and not so freaking hot....right in the middle. Can get down to 0 or sub0 for a few days per winter, but not harsh... Zone 5-6 depending on where in the state so most things grow just fine (citrus cannot survive the winter outside) Lots of "recreation" here if you like redneck recreation. I can walk out my back door and go shooting, drinking, 4 wheeling etc. Mountain biking in popular in the state (plenty of mountains...) as is white water rafting down the New River. Lots of fishing lakes if that is your thing and big reseviors suitable for high-speed boating/tubing/skiing. Snow skiing also is available in the winter time, again with the mountains. Decent wages for blue collar jobs (Oil and gas and coal mining) if that is your thing. Not drought conditions like in the midwest. I've gotten plenty of rain this summer. Just right actually, didn't even need to water my garden after getting it established in the spring. Castle Doctrine Cons: vehicle "saftey" inspections piss me off. Forces you to go to a garage once a year to have some asshole tell you your "oil cooling lines" (which my truck doesn't even have...) need replaced and you will fail the inspection unless you do it. I took it to another garage and they passed it with no issues. Just annoying. No emissions testing though, just petty stuff like not enough tread left on the tires so you have to buy new ones, etc...They usually try to get you on "bad wheel bearings" because they can fail you for that...and they're cheap parts but expensive to replace. Its a state sponsored bailout to mechanics/garages IMO.
